Book Overview
This meticulously researched volume dives into fourteen of the most celebrated rivalries in college football history. From the legendary battles between the Ohio State Buckeyes and the Michigan Wolverines to the in-state fury of the Auburn Tigers versus the Alabama Crimson Tide, each chapter captures the drama, the heroes, and the raw emotion that define these matchups. Gitlin explores not just the scores, but the stories behind the games—the traditions, the fan cultures, and the coaches who turned these contests into legends.
Key Highlights
- Comprehensive coverage of 14 iconic rivalries including the Civil War (Oregon vs. Oregon State) and the Iron Bowl (Auburn vs. Alabama)
- Rich historical context that explains how each rivalry began and evolved over decades
- Memorable game highlights with play-by-play drama that keeps you on the edge of your seat
- Profiles of legendary players and coaches who left an indelible mark on these matchups
- Fan perspectives that reveal the rituals, chants, and unwavering loyalty that make these games special
Inside the Book
The book is organized into fourteen detailed chapters, each dedicated to a single rivalry. You will find vivid descriptions of iconic games—like the 2006 No. 1 vs. No. 2 showdown between Ohio State and Michigan, or the 2013 Iron Bowl's 'Kick Six' finish. Gitlin also delves into the cultural significance of these rivalries, from tailgate traditions to the emotional impact on entire states. The narrative is engaging, blending statistical analysis with storytelling that feels as electric as a live broadcast.
